DescriptionCVE.org

Nezha Monitoring is a self-hostable, lightweight, servers and websites monitoring and O&M tool. From version 2.0.14 to before version 2.1.0, authenticated users can claim the dashboard Host through NAT and preempt all dashboard routing. This issue has been patched in version 2.1.0.

AnalysisAI

Nezha Monitoring versions 2.0.14 through 2.1.0 (exclusive) allows any authenticated user to exploit the NAT-based Host claiming mechanism to preempt all dashboard routing, resulting in complete availability loss for the monitoring platform. The vulnerability stems from CWE-284 (Improper Access Control) - the application fails to properly restrict which authenticated principals may register or override a dashboard Host identity via NAT traversal. No public exploit has been identified at time of analysis, and this vulnerability is not listed in the CISA KEV catalog.

Technical ContextAI

Nezha Monitoring (CPE: cpe:2.3:a:nezhahq:nezha) is a self-hosted, lightweight server and website monitoring and operations management tool that supports NAT traversal for agent-to-dashboard communication. The NAT host claim mechanism - designed to allow agents behind NAT to register themselves with the dashboard - lacks sufficient access controls (CWE-284: Improper Access Control) to verify that an authenticated user is authorized to claim or override a specific dashboard Host entry. By manipulating this registration pathway, any low-privileged authenticated user can preempt the routing table for the entire dashboard, displacing legitimate agents and disrupting the monitoring service. The scope is limited to the dashboard's own routing, with no scope change to external systems.

RemediationAI

Upgrade Nezha Monitoring to version 2.1.0 or later, which contains the vendor-released patch for this issue. Details are available in the GitHub Security Advisory at https://github.com/nezhahq/nezha/security/advisories/GHSA-x6fg-52vr-hj4w. If an immediate upgrade is not possible, restrict dashboard account creation to trusted principals only, as the attack requires an authenticated session - reducing the pool of legitimate users limits exposure. Additionally, network-layer access controls (e.g., firewall rules, VPN gateway) that restrict who can reach the dashboard's NAT registration endpoint would reduce the effective attack surface, though this is a compensating control, not a fix. Neither workaround eliminates the underlying access control flaw.
